Optimizing Profits from a System of Accounts Receivable
Stanford, Robert E. - In: Management Science 35 (1989) 10, pp. 1227-1235
We develop a model of the period-by-period maintenance cost and interest income accumulation resulting from charges to a system of accounts receivable, and establish conditions under which the present value of the expected profit generated by the charges reaches its greatest attainable levels....
